The 1997258 97 1500 2500 3500 vapor canister purge solenoid, manufactured by General Motors, is an essential component in the fuel system of various vehicles. This solenoid is primarily responsible for controlling the flow of vapors from the fuel tank to the evaporative emission control system.
This vapor canister purge solenoid is a crucial part of the vehicle's onboard refueling vapor recovery (ORVR) system. It operates by opening and closing an electrical valve in response to electrical signals from the engine control module (ECM). When the valve is open, the vapors from the fuel tank are allowed to flow into the engine intake system, where they can be burned off as fuel.
